Company

Model Name:

company.company

Inherits from:

Party

Base Module:

Company

Menu:

Party ‣ Configuration ‣ Companies

Party ‣ Configuration ‣ Companies ‣ Companies

The Company-model introduces the conception of ...

Fields

Children:
Internal Name:childs
Type:One-To-Many
Relation Model:Company

The children records in a tree-structure. See section Tree.

Currency:
Internal Name:currency
Attributes:Required
Type:Many-To-One
Relation Model:Currency

The Currency-field is used to store ...

Employees:
Internal Name:employees
Type:One-To-Many
Relation Model:Employee

The Employees-field is used to store ...

Header:
Internal Name:header
Type:Multi Line Text

The Header-field is used to store ...

Hours per Work Day:
Internal Name:hours_per_work_day
Attributes:Required
Type:Float Number
Base Module:Company Work Time

The Hours per Work Day-field is used to store ...

Hours per Work Month:
Internal Name:hours_per_work_month
Attributes:Required
Type:Float Number
Base Module:Company Work Time

The Hours per Work Month-field is used to store ...

Hours per Work Week:
Internal Name:hours_per_work_week
Attributes:Required
Type:Float Number
Base Module:Company Work Time

The Hours per Work Week-field is used to store ...

Hours per Work Year:
Internal Name:hours_per_work_year
Attributes:Required
Type:Float Number
Base Module:Company Work Time

The Hours per Work Year-field is used to store ...

Parent:
Internal Name:parent
Type:Many-To-One
Relation Model:Company

The parent record in a tree-structure. See section Tree.

Access

The manipulation of records in this model is controlled by Model access entries. Users being member of Group “Party Administration” have the following access permissions:

Read:allowed
Write:allowed
Create:allowed
Delete:allowed

All other Users have these access permissions:

Read:allowed
Write:forbidden
Create:forbidden
Delete:forbidden

Company Config Init

Model Name:company.company.config.init
Base Module:Company

The Company Config Init-model introduces the conception of ...

Employee

Model Name:company.employee
Inherits from:Party
Base Module:Company
Menu:Party ‣ Configuration ‣ Employees

The Employee-model introduces the conception of ...

Fields

Company:
Internal Name:company
Attributes:Required
Type:Many-To-One
Relation Model:Company

The Company-field is used to store ...

Cost Price:
Internal Name:cost_price
Attributes:Read Only
Type:Numeric Number
Base Module:Project Revenue

Hourly cost price for this Employee

Cost Prices:
Internal Name:cost_prices
Type:One-To-Many
Relation Model:Employee Cost Price
Base Module:Project Revenue

List of hourly cost price over time

Access

The manipulation of records in this model is controlled by Model access entries. Users being member of Group “Party Administration” have the following access permissions:

Read:allowed
Write:allowed
Create:allowed
Delete:allowed

All other Users have these access permissions:

Read:allowed
Write:forbidden
Create:forbidden
Delete:forbidden

Table Of Contents

Previous topic

Company

Next topic

Company Work Time

This Page